原创 黑客帝國之酷炫屏保數字雨

本程序vs2013 測試通過,不排除其他測試通過用例,主要是windows API的應用 #include <windows.h> #define ID_TIMER 1 #define STRMAXLEN 25 //

原创 日誌記錄-20151103

今天沒幹啥,C++primer依舊是重中之重,計算機圖形學已經考完了,今天獎勵自己碼半晚上代碼啦啦啦。考完試結束第九章。代碼代碼,我待你如潮水般洶涌。你卻搭理都不搭理我。總有一天,我會站在你頭上,笑着對你說:你還是我的初戀。

原创 一步一步熟知設計模式--初識

設計模式-初識 –對於設計模式早已神往已久,有幸得來設計模式:可複用的面向對象軟件的基礎。決定花點時間學習學習。剛開始,對於這本書有個總體概念,思維導圖是利用xmind製作,當然市面上還有其他類似的軟件。我覺得下面的還是很棒的,就

原创 C++primer--拷貝控制__構造函數和析構函數的執行時期

#include<iostream> #include<vector> using namespace std; struct X { X() { cout << "這裏是構造函數X()" << endl; }

原创 python粘結shell監聽端口設置

通過python粘接,替代了shell判斷狀態是否ok的步驟。簡單方便 #encoding=utf8 import os import time import socket import commands def checktcp(i

原创 WEB服務器、應用程序服務器、HTTP服務器區別

WEB服務器、應用程序服務器、HTTP服務器區別   WEB服務器、應用程序服務器、HTTP服務器有何區別?IIS、Apache、Tomcat、Weblogic、WebSphere都各屬於哪種服務器,這些問題困惑了很久,今天終於梳理清楚了

原创 對於sizeof的用法測試

如果你不懂sizeof的用法,我想看了這個代碼你就會一清二楚,甚至不用講解。 話不多說:上代碼~~~ /****************************************************************

原创 典型的進程間通信IPC問題-生產者消費者問題

本實例詳細解釋了生產者消費者問題的簡易模型,對於同步互斥以及多線程處理此問題提出了一個較好的解決方案。 #include <stdio.h> #include <pthread.h> #define MAX 10000000000

原创 一個簡易的http服務器。

從代碼邏輯我們可以很清晰的看出簡單的http服務器鎖遵循的框架,以及後臺調用的過程 並在此,應用了,多進程,進程間通信的管道,以及網絡通信socket的知識 /**************************************

原创 Python學習基礎之函數

當出現函數的時候世界的曙光出現了,重複的事情變得簡單 python提供了很多內置的函數供開發者使用,方便了管理,對於API的使用,可以使用help(命令)形同於linux下的man手冊 def Whichbig(a,b,c)

原创 阿里雲Centos下安裝mysql找不到mysql-sever安裝包的解決方案

解決方案 採用yum源安裝,yum install mysql mysql-sever mysql-client很多教程上都這麼寫,實際上也是對的,對於大多數centos系統默認源來講,確實如此。 但是在阿里雲服務器上,默認是阿里雲

原创 APUE之對於系統中缺失的error.c文件的階段性總結

大多數人在學習APUE過程中都會受到缺失apue.h和error.c文件的困擾 本文意指在學習完整個APUE的過程中對於error.c 文件由原官方文件的基礎上做出的N次擴充,也就是說在以後的學習中,基本上所有代碼的包含了apue.h的

原创 arpa/inet.h

從man手冊獲取到的inet.h信息。在linux下網絡編程程中常用頭文件,主要是信息轉換,將客戶端信息,轉換爲字符串信息。 <arpa/inet.h>(0P) POSIX Programmer's Manual

原创 一些後臺開發的基本問題(需要懂得)

Linux後臺開發應該具備技能 一、linux和os: 1、命令:netstat tcpdump ipcs ipcrm 這四個命令的熟練掌握程度基本上能體現實際開發和調試程序的經驗 2、cpu 內存 硬盤 等等與系統性能調試相關的

原创 基礎之快速排序(霍爾排序)

快排屬於不穩定排序,時間複雜度爲nlogn最好最壞都是如此。 對於不穩定排序來說: - 基於比較就是在一趟排序後不能保證此躺排序相等元素順序保持不變,那麼就稱之爲不穩定排序 - 快排的要點就是在選擇基準點時採用隨機取法,當然取第一個